About The Position

NiteLines USA, established in 1994, is a dynamic and growing healthcare organization that delivers contract support services to government institutions and medical treatment facilities. We are seeking dedicated individuals to join our team in Portland, OR, where integrity, respect, accountability, and collaboration are core principles. This role involves providing essential medical coding services to ensure accurate billing and data collection.

Requirements

  • Certified Coder shall have at least one of the following credentials from the American Health Information Management Association (AHIMA): Registered Health Information Technician (RHIT), Certified Coding Specialist (CCS or CCS-P), or Registered Health Information Administrator (RHIA) or American Academy of Professional Coders (AAPC) Certified Professional Coder (CPC).
  • Knowledge of all VA software, VIRR, Usage of E&M calculator in VIRR as mandated by the VISN, and International Classification of Diseases-Version 10 (ICD-10) for both Diagnosis coding (CM) and Facility Procedure Coding System (PCS).
  • Must be a citizen of the United States.

Responsibilities

  • Diagnosis Related Groupings (DRGs), ICD-10 CM, ICD-10 PCS, and HCPCS coding and be able to provide medical record coding.
  • Review coding and assist MRTs (Coder) in ensuring timeliness and improving coding accuracy.
  • Provide coding guidance to various levels of staff to promote consistency in practice and compliance with coding rules and regulations.
  • Initiate, prepare, and maintain various reports, and analyze data.
  • Coordinate, assign, and monitor workflow.
  • Provide input for performance evaluations and hiring.
  • Orient and instruct new coding personnel and/or students on coding, abstracting, and use of the electronic health record and encoder software.
  • Ensure audit findings and claim denials related to coding errors are resolved and/or daily coding rejections corrected for accurate billing and data collection.
  • Monitor trends and/or changes in regulatory and policy requirements affecting coding practices and identify educational needs.
  • Develop coding training materials and present a curriculum encompassing ongoing training initiatives.
